摘要

Abstract

Objective To analyze the action mechanism of Taohong Siwu Decoction(桃红四物汤,THSWD)in relieving lower extremity arteriosclerosis obliterans(ASO)in mice by inhibiting the TLR4/MyD88/NF-κB signaling pathway.Methods Twelve male C57BL/6 mice were selected as the blank group,and 48 8-week male ApoE mice were randomly divided into the model group,low-dose group,medium-dose group,and high-dose group,with 12 mice in each group.The blank group was fed with a normal diet,while the other groups were fed with a high-fat diet.Starting from the 9th week,the mice were gavaged;the blank group and model group received 0.2 mL of normal saline(NS)daily,while the remaining groups received0.2 mL of THSWD daily.After converting doses between humans and mice,the final dosages for various groups were approximately 0.06 g/day for the low-dose group,0.13 g/day for the medium-dose group,and 0.26 g/day for the high-dose group,with a consecutive 12 weeks of gavage.Hematoxylin-eosin(HE)staining was used to observe the morphological changes in the arterial vessels of mice;an automatic biochemical analyzer to measure the blood lipid levels in the mice;Western blot(WB)was used to detect the expressions of TLR4,MYD88,p65,p-p65,IKB,and p-pIKB in the vascular tissues.Results Compared with the blank group,mice in the model group,low-dose group,medium-dose group,and high-dose group showed significant formation of atherosclerotic plaques,while the atherosclerosis degree was significantly reduced in the low-dose,medium-dose,and high-dose groups compared to the model group.Compared with the blank group,LDL,CHO,and TG levels in the other groups were significantly elevated,while HDL level was decreased.After intervening with THSWD,the LDL,CHO,and TG levels in the low-dose,medium-dose,and high-dose groups were significantly reduced compared to the model group,while HDL levels significantly increased(P<0.05).Compared with the blank group,the expressions of TLR4,MYD88,p-IκB,and p-P65 in the other groups were significantly increased.After intervening with THSWD,the expressions of TLR4,MYD88,p-IκB,and p-P65 in the low-dose,medium-dose,and high-dose groups were significantly reduced compared to the model group(P<0.05).Conclusion THSWD can lower blood lipid levels in mice and inhibit the progression of atherosclerosis,and its mechanism of action may be related to the inhibition of the TLR4/MyD88/NF-κB signaling pathway.
